Should I keep VSync on or off?

The answer is simple. If screen tearing interferes with your gaming experience and causes frequent screen tears, you should enable VSync. On the other hand, if you are facing input lag or a decreased frame rate, turning VSync OFF will be the correct alternative.

Does VSync stop stuttering?

But if you have less fps than Hz, VSync will reduce the number of frames by half. This results in stuttering. So if your video card only reaches 59 fps, VSync will lower it to 30 fps. That means you should only set up VSync if your fps is higher than your refresh rate.

Why is VSync so laggy?

However, this forces the GPU to queue up frames, instead of sending them as fast as possible. Because of queuing, conventional vsync can add as much as 50ms of latency on top of your display's baseline input lag. This is where low-lag vsync comes into the picture.

Should VSync be on with 144Hz?

Keep in mind that the higher the refresh rate of your monitor is, the less noticeable screen tearing will be. That's why most competitive FPS gamers with monitors with a refresh rate of 144Hz or higher don't enable V-SYNC – since screen tearing is generally less of an issue than the added input lag.

Can VSync cause screen tearing?

When VSync is enabled and the frame rate drops below the monitor's refresh rate, the frame rate fluctuates wildly, causing visible stuttering. When VSync is disabled in-game, screen tearing is observed when the frame rate exceeds the refresh rate of the display (120 frames per second on a 60Hz display, for example).
